Career Credit is where you can earn college credits by performing certain kinds of work- as an intern, of course, not paid. There is another type of career credit whereby they will give you units for work already performed.
The exact term I am not sure of, because I don't know if the concept even exists in the Spanish speaking world. "Crédito (or unidades) por trabajo" would be a translation. "Credits (or units) for work."
Google translate gives "créditos de carrera." but I doubt that the Google translator understands the concept. The SpanishDict translator gives similar translations.
